package httpfsd
import (
"fmt"
"io"
"net/http"
"os"
"path"
"github.com/golang-migrate/migrate/v4/source"
)
type httpfsDriver struct {
migrations *source.Migrations
fs http.FileSystem
path string
}
func New(fs http.FileSystem, path string) (source.Driver, error) {
root, err := fs.Open(path)
if err != nil {
return nil, err
}
files, err := root.Readdir(0)
if err != nil {
_ = root.Close()
return nil, err
}
if err = root.Close(); err != nil {
return nil, err
}
ms := source.NewMigrations()
for _, file := range files {
if file.IsDir() {
continue
}
m, err := source.DefaultParse(file.Name())
if err != nil {
continue // ignore files that we can't parse
}
if !ms.Append(m) {
return nil, fmt.Errorf("duplicate migration file: %v", file.Name())
}
}
driver := &httpfsDriver{
fs: fs,
path: path,
migrations: ms,
}
return driver, nil
}
func (h *httpfsDriver) Open(url string) (source.Driver, error) {
return nil, fmt.Errorf("not implemented")
}
func (h *httpfsDriver) Close() error {
return nil
}
func (h *httpfsDriver) First() (uint, error) {
if v, ok := h.migrations.First(); ok {
return v, nil
}
return 0, &os.PathError{
Op: "first",
Path: h.path,
Err: os.ErrNotExist,
}
}
func (h *httpfsDriver) Prev(version uint) (uint, error) {
if v, ok := h.migrations.Prev(version); ok {
return v, nil
}
return 0, &os.PathError{
Op: fmt.Sprintf("prev for version %v", version),
Path: h.path,
Err: os.ErrNotExist,
}
}
func (h *httpfsDriver) Next(version uint) (uint, error) {
if v, ok := h.migrations.Next(version); ok {
return v, nil
}
return 0, &os.PathError{
Op: fmt.Sprintf("next for version %v", version),
Path: h.path,
Err: os.ErrNotExist,
}
}
func (h *httpfsDriver) ReadUp(version uint) (io.ReadCloser, string, error) {
m, ok := h.migrations.Up(version)
if !ok {
return nil, "", &os.PathError{
Op: fmt.Sprintf("read version %v", version),
Path: h.path,
Err: os.ErrNotExist,
}
}
body, err := h.fs.Open(path.Join(h.path, m.Raw))
if err != nil {
return nil, "", err
}
return body, m.Identifier, nil
}
func (h *httpfsDriver) ReadDown(version uint) (io.ReadCloser, string, error) {
m, ok := h.migrations.Down(version)
if !ok {
return nil, "", &os.PathError{
Op: fmt.Sprintf("read version %v", version),
Path: h.path,
Err: os.ErrNotExist,
}
}
body, err := h.fs.Open(path.Join(h.path, m.Raw))
if err != nil {
return nil, "", err
}
return body, m.Identifier, nil
}
